I set up a 30gal tank with a layer of organic potting soil with a layer of Eco earth on top . I wet both down lightly by spraying distilled water. There's a few river rocks that I washed thoroughly , some living lettuce plants of he wants a snack and a hide a hut in the middle between the hot and cool zone .
I'm heating the tank with a heating pad from underneath and a 75w heat lamp and a UVB lamp ( both of which I am thinking of upgrading$$ )
